Appium Maven Bağımlılığı: Proje Örneğiyle Kurulum

Nedir? Apache Maven?

Apache Maven bir Javatabanlı proje yönetimi ve otomasyon aracı. Geliştiricilerin tüm yapı yaşam döngüsünü kolaylaştırması için çoklu görev çerçevesi sağlar. Java uygulamalar. Maven, POM (Proje Nesne Modeli) adı verilen ve 'pom.xml' olarak anılan bir XML biçiminde önceden tanımlanmış ve bildirilmiştir. Ayrıca C#, Scala, Ruby vb. gibi diğer diller için de kullanılabilir.
Maven çerçevesini kullanarak herhangi bir projede aşağıdaki görevleri kolayca yönetebiliriz:

  • Yapı döngüsü
  • Proje belgeleri
  • Rapor Kontrolleri
  • Scrum yönetimi
  • Bilgi vermek

Maven'in temel kullanımları:

  • Standart bir dizin yapısını zorlar.
  • Yeniden kullanılabilir ve bakımı kolay bir proje yapısı sağlayın.
  • Paket bağımlılıklarını çözün.
  • Bir yapılandırma yönetimi çerçevesi sağlayın.

İndiriniz Appium Maven Bağımlılıkları

Maven ile APPIUM bağımlılık testini yazmaya başlamadan önce, indirmemiz gerekiyor Appium Maven bağımlılığı Appium JAR dosyasını şuradan indirin: Maven merkezi deposu https://serdartavaslioglu.com sitesi üzerinden ücretsiz erişebilirseniz.

İndiriniz Appium Maven Bağımlılıkları

veya doğrudan aşağıda belirtilen POM.xml yapıtını ekleyin:

<dependency>
  <groupId>io.appium</groupId>
  <artifactId>java-client</artifactId>
  <version>3.4.1</version>
</dependency>

Lütfen bizim üzerinden geçin Maven öğreticisi Maven'i nasıl yapılandıracağınızı öğrenmek için Eclipse.

APPIUM ve Maven ile Uygulamanın Test Edilmesi

yapılandırdıktan sonra Appium Java Maven eklentisi Eclipse. Herhangi bir android .apk uygulamasını test etmeye hazır olacak Appium ve Maven şekilde gösterildiği gibi Appium Maven proje örneği aşağıdadır.

) 1 Adım Bu adımda,

  1. YENİ'ye gidin >> Maven projesini seçin
  2. 'İleri' düğmesine tıklayın

APPIUM ve Maven ile Uygulamanın Test Edilmesi

) 2 Adım Daha sonra 'Yeni Maven Projesi' penceresine ' girinAppium Grup Kimliği ve Yapı Kimliği sütununda Test'. Bu adımda giriş yapmalısınız.

  1. Grup kimliği
  2. Yapı Kimliği
  3. Sürümü
  4. Paketleme
  5. Isim ve Descriptiyon
  6. Bitiş

APPIUM ve Maven ile Uygulamanın Test Edilmesi

Bitir butonuna tıklıyoruz. Tanımlanan Grup Kimliğinde yeni bir sınıf açacaktır (AppiumTest) adı.

) 3 Adım Başlangıç ​​olarak Appium senaryo. Sol taraftaki explorer penceresinden 'src/main/java'ya sağ tıklayın. Daha sonra Yeni >> sınıfı seçin. Yaz Appium seçilen sınıfın içindeki kod.

APPIUM ve Maven ile Uygulamanın Test Edilmesi

) 4 Adım Aynı projede sol explorer menüsünden pom.xml'ye tıklayın. Tüm bağımlılıklar varsayılan olarak 'pom.xml' sekmesinde görünür olacaktır. Aşağıdaki Resme bakın-

APPIUM ve Maven ile Uygulamanın Test Edilmesi

Varsayılan pom.xml mevcut değilse tüm Maven'i ekleyin Appium bağımlılıklar. (Maven merkezi veri deposu web sitesinden alıntıdır}

http://search.maven.org/#search|gav|1|g%3A%22io.appium%22%20AND%20a%3A%22java-client%22

APPIUM ve Maven ile Uygulamanın Test Edilmesi

) 5 Adım Şimdi soldaki gezginden 'pom.xml' dosyasına sağ tıklayın veya ' için xml kodunun üzerine tıklayın.AppiumTest' projesi. Daha sonra 'Farklı Çalıştır >> Maven Clean' seçeneğini tıklayın.

APPIUM ve Maven ile Uygulamanın Test Edilmesi

Çalışırken, kullanıcı tüm Maven ile ilgili jar dosyalarını ve başarı mesajını görebilir. Bu nedenle, bu şekilde kullanıcı APPIUM'u çalıştırabilir. Java Maven yapılandırılmış ortamıyla istemci Maven bağımlılık testi.

APPIUM ve Maven ile Uygulamanın Test Edilmesi

ÖZET

  • Maven, JAVA tabanlı bir Proje Yönetim Çerçevesidir.
  • POM (Project Object Model) olarak adlandırılan ve 'pom.xml' olarak adlandırılan XML formatında önceden tanımlanmış ve bildirilmiştir.